WebLike all crustaceans, crawfish are not kosher because they are aquatic animals that have neither fins nor scales. They are therefore not eaten by observant Jews. Boiling alive. Crawfish are an outstanding source of top quality protein and low in calories, fat and hydrogenated fat. They likewise are a great source of vitamin B12, niacin, iron, copper and selenium. “Crawfish are simple to prepare, and they taste terrific,” Reames says. great whites life cycle

Web10 apr. 2024 · To eat crawfish, first, you'll need to remove the head from the tail. You can do this by twisting the head and pulling it away from the tail. Some people like to suck the juices out of the head, which is where the "sucking heads" part of the phrase comes from. One serving of crawfish … Web23 mrt. 2024 · To make etouffee, once you've finished creating a roux, add celery, pepper, and onions, stirring until coated. Add in chicken broth, water, and Creole seasonings to your taste. Cover and simmer for 30 minutes, stirring occasionally. Add your crawfish (or shrimp), heat through, and serve over rice (via Taste of Home ).
